Thermoelectric energy conversion devices and systems
Yazawa, Kazuaki.
Thermoelectric energy conversion devices and systems - Singapore; World Scientific Publishing Co. Pte. Ltd., 2021. - xxiv, 364p. - WSPC series in advanced integration and packaging ; volume 7 .
This unique compendium emphasizes key factors driving the performance of thermoelectric energy conversion systems. Important design parameters such as heat transfer at the boundaries of the system, material properties, and form factors are carefully analyzed and optimized for performance including the cost-performance trade-off. Numbers of examples are provided on the applications of thermoelectric technologies, e. g. , power generation, cooling of electronic components, and waste heat recovery in wearable devices. This book provides a comprehensive treatment of thermoelectric energy conversion devices and systems, emphasizing the physical principles, materials, device design, modeling, fabrication, packaging, and system integration of thermoelectric technologies. It discusses heat transfer, electrical transport, optimization of thermoelectric performance, efficiency, reliability, and cost-performance trade-offs. Practical applications including waste heat recovery, renewable energy harvesting, cooling systems, and electronic thermal management are presented with numerous examples. The volume also introduces interactive modeling tools to assist researchers, engineers, and graduate students in the design, analysis, and optimization of thermoelectric energy conversion systems.
